Lions All-Star FB Game on Saturday

Players and coaches for the North team pose together after practice for the 47th edition of the Lions All-Star Football Game.
Players and coaches for the North team took a photo after practice for the 47th edition of the Lions All-Star Football Game. Photo: Mark Tennis.

Booker Guyton, head coach at Edison of Stockton and leader of the North team, spent the opening days of practice adjusting after nearly 10 previously committed players opted out before the week began. By Wednesday, the North had regrouped with 26 players at practice, including several recent Edison graduates and a few additions from other schools, giving the roster enough talent and size up front to stay competitive for Saturday night's matchup.

The South team had a steadier buildup at Gregori High in Modesto. Coaches Trent Merzon of Oakdale and Tim Garcia of Davis of Modesto finalized the roster by Wednesday after a few late additions and withdrawals, while veteran assistants Mike Glines and Mark Malone helped guide preparations.

The 47th Central California Lions All-Star Football Game marked the event's return for the first time since 2019 after the COVID-19 pandemic. The game was set for Saturday, June 24, 2023 at Wayne Schneider Stadium on the campus of Tracy High School, with the North serving as the home team. The North entered the game holding a 25-19-1 edge in the all-time series.

Fans could buy tickets online through GoFan for $10, while on-site purchases for tickets, t-shirts, concessions, and game programs were listed as cash only. Both teams were scheduled to continue practicing on Thursday and Friday from 5 to 7 p.m., with the North at Edison High and the South at Gregori High.
